AudioDeviceCmdlets 项目推荐
项目基础介绍和主要编程语言
AudioDeviceCmdlets 是一个用于控制 Windows 音频设备的 PowerShell Cmdlet 套件。该项目的主要编程语言是 C#,它充分利用了 .NET Framework 和 PowerShell 的强大功能,为用户提供了一套简单易用的命令行工具来管理音频设备。
项目核心功能
AudioDeviceCmdlets 提供了丰富的功能来管理和控制 Windows 上的音频设备,包括但不限于:
- 获取所有音频设备的列表
- 获取默认的音频设备(播放/录制)
- 获取默认的通信音频设备(播放/录制)
- 获取默认音频设备的音量和静音状态(播放/录制)
- 获取默认通信音频设备的音量和静音状态(播放/录制)
- 设置默认的音频设备(播放/录制)
- 设置默认的通信音频设备(播放/录制)
- 设置默认音频设备的音量和静音状态(播放/录制)
- 设置默认通信音频设备的音量和静音状态(播放/录制)
项目最近更新的功能
最近,AudioDeviceCmdlets 项目引入了以下新功能:
- 增加了对默认通信播放设备和录制设备的音量和静音状态的控制
- 新增了
Write-AudioDevice
Cmdlet,用于将默认播放和录制设备的功率输出写入为仪表或流 - 改进了安装和构建过程,提供了更详细的构建说明,包括使用 Visual Studio 2022 进行构建的步骤
- 增加了对 .NET Framework 4.6.1+ 的支持,确保项目在最新的 .NET 环境中运行稳定
通过这些更新,AudioDeviceCmdlets 项目不仅增强了其功能性,还提高了用户的使用体验,使其成为管理和控制 Windows 音频设备的理想工具。